Soft or Sticky Spray Foam: What Needs Investigation?

Some cured open-cell foams are flexible, so softness alone does not prove failure. Persistent tackiness, oiliness, unexpected texture, or breakdown after the documented cure period needs product-specific assessment before the material is disturbed or covered.

The short answer

For persistent tackiness, oiliness, unexpected breakdown, or accompanying symptoms, stop work and restrict access. Do not trim, heat, coat, or cover suspect foam. Document the product and pattern, then obtain manufacturer guidance and qualified assessment.

Compare with the intended material

Open-cell insulation can be semiflexible after curing; Natural Resources Canada’s material guide describes that physical distinction. We use this reference for material behavior only, not U.S. code requirements. Neither a hard surface nor a flexible surface establishes chemical cure or indoor-air safety.

Compare the observation with the exact formulation’s expected condition. Do not press bare fingers into suspect material as a test. Persistent oily or tacky areas, unexpected crumbling, substantial shrinkage, or accompanying symptoms warrant escalation.

What the symptom can mean

Possible mechanisms include materials outside their conditioning range, poor substrate conditions, incomplete component mixing, off-ratio foam, expired or damaged product, a blocked nozzle, lift or cure errors, and cross-contamination. A photograph cannot reliably identify the chemistry.

Record whether the pattern follows a spray pass, a nozzle change, or a particular substrate. These observations help the manufacturer select what to investigate; they cannot identify an A-rich or B-rich mix from appearance. Safe documentation

Without touching the material, photograph a labeled grid and record the time since application, ambient conditions, product identity, lot numbers, and installer observations. Preserve samples only when a qualified professional specifies safe collection and chain of custody.

Ask the manufacturer for written evaluation criteria. Ask the installer for start-up checks, temperature logs, lift records, nozzle changes, and shutdown events.

Why covering is the wrong next step

Finishes can hide whether the material is continuing to change and can complicate removal. Adding properly cured foam on top does not establish that the lower layer is acceptable. Heat and mechanical disturbance can add exposure.

The resolution may range from a small controlled removal to a larger remediation and indoor-environment assessment. The scope should be based on the affected area, chemistry, symptoms, ventilation path, and substrate impact.
